An Oklahoma airport authority is seeking a vendor to provide a cloud-based parking counting and occupancy monitoring system for its facilities. The desired solution must accurately track vehicle ingress and egress in real time, deliver reliable occupancy data for each individual parking facility, and offer robust cloud-based monitoring, reporting, and integration features.
Key system requirements include scalability, flexible installation options, and long-term operational reliability. Integration with future airport systems—such as PARCS, mobile applications, and digital signage—is essential, with the platform supporting API-based data sharing and offering a mobile-friendly dashboard interface. The solution must ensure continuous local tracking of vehicle counts during network disruptions and automatically synchronize data when connectivity is restored. Additional features include a real-time connection status indicator for all monitored systems, a map-based interface displaying all locations, support for unlimited user accounts, and a comprehensive API for third-party system integration.
The initial contract period will span one year. Interested vendors should note key dates, including a site visit scheduled for January 29, 2026, and a deadline for submitting questions by January 21, 2026.
